Originally Posted by Chickenminer
The old Manning #9s I have were stamped with my initials and a serial #. Did Manning or Titus or both serial # the traps ?

Steve Titus stamped the trappers initials and the the number of the trap he made. The first 12 traps Titus sold and were stamped, belonged to Ron Long.
As far as i know, Manning never stamped traps. Manning made very few traps overall.

Originally Posted by milkcrate
Who changed the name of the trap from Manning to Alaska? When did that happen? I had both Manning #9s and Alaska #9s.

Dean Willson changed the shortly after bought it from Steve Titus. I forget what year that was. Maybe Elder Buist, the historian knows. I had it all wrote down, think i gave it to JR.

Originally Posted by Slick Pan
Good information and history.I knew most of it but still there was some things learned.Thank you! Someone must have one they want to sell?

If you are wanting a Frist year Dean Wilson trap. Look for a hand stamped pan "Alaskan No. 9". It will be arc welded, and i believe it will have a round pipe made swivel.
